Job Duties
- manage the full lifecycle of conferences and events from pre-event planning to onsite execution
- coordinate with vendors, facilitators, participants, and stakeholders to ensure seamless communication
- schedule and organize event logistics including transportation, accommodations, catering, and audiovisual needs
- oversee budget management, invoice processing, and contract administration
- utilize planning tools such as Smartsheet to track progress and participant details
- anticipate and resolve potential risks related to event execution
- lead event activities to create engaging and collaborative atmosphere
